Definitions:

Emotion-Controlling Centers

Refers to specific brain regions, such as the amygdala, prefrontal cortex, and hippocampus, involved in regulating and processing emotions.

Psychosurgery

Surgical interventions aimed at treating mental disorders by removing or altering parts of the brain.

Lobotomies

A now outdated surgical procedure once used to treat mental illness, which involved severing connections in the brain's prefrontal cortex.
